Why the Order of Draw Matters ⁤in Blood Collection

The order in which blood collection tubes are ⁤filled during​ phlebotomy isn’t arbitrary; it ⁤is carefully designed based on the type ⁢of additives​ in each ⁤tube. This order prevents cross-contamination ​of additives,which can ⁣interfere with‌ test results,and ensures the​ blood sample’s integrity. Incorrect⁣ order‍ of draw can ‍lead to:

  • Contamination of samples with additives from previous tubes
  • Hemolysis due to⁢ improper technique, which hampers lab accuracy
  • Inaccurate test ‌results leading to misdiagnosis or delayed diagnosis
  • Patient safety‍ issues from improper collection procedures

The Standardized Order of Draw in Phlebotomy

The Clinical and laboratory‌ Standards Institute (CLSI) and the National Committee for⁣ Clinical Laboratory Standards (NCCLS) ⁢recommend a specific order of draw that⁣ most ⁣healthcare providers follow. Here is an easy-to-understand table detailing the standard sequence:

Step Tube Type Color/additive Purpose
1 Sterile Blood Culture​ Tubes Yellow‍ /‍ Sodium Polyanethol Sulfonate (SPS) Detects bloodstream infections
2 Sterile Tubes for Sterility Testing Yellow / SPS / Clot Activator Microbial testing
3 Sodium ⁤Citrate Tubes Light Blue Coagulation tests (PT, PTT, INR)
4 Serum Tubes—Clot Activator Red or Gold⁣ / Serum Separator Tube (SST) Serum chemistry, serology, ​blood bank
5 Heparin Tubes PST or Green /⁢ Lithium Heparin Electrolytes, hormone levels
6 EDTA Tubes Lavender ⁣or Pink Hematology, blood Banking
7 Oxalate / Fluoride Tubes Grey Blood glucose testing, ⁤genetics

Note:

The sequence may⁣ vary slightly based on guidelines or specific laboratory protocols, but ⁣adhering to this order ‍is crucial for accurate diagnostic outcomes.

Practical​ Tips for Mastering the Order of Draw and‌ Blood Collection

Preparing ⁢for the Blood Draw

  • Check the order of draw before starting ​the procedure.
  • Verify patient‌ ID to prevent ​errors.
  • Gather‍ all supplies including tubes, gloves, needles, and alcohol ⁤swabs.
  • Explain the procedure to the patient to ease ‍anxiety.

Step-by-Step ⁢Collection Technique

  1. Wash hands and put on gloves.
  2. Apply a tourniquet around the patient’s upper arm.
  3. Choose⁤ and clean‍ the site with alcohol swab ‍and let⁢ it‌ dry.
  4. Insert the needle smoothly ⁤into the vein at a ⁣15-30 degree angle.
  5. Fill tubes in ⁤the ​correct sequence, filling each appropriately.
  6. Release the tourniquet onc enough blood is collected.
  7. Withdraw the needle carefully, ​and apply pressure to stop‍ bleeding.
  8. Label tubes accurately promptly after ‍collection.

Handling‍ the Samples

  • Invert tubes gently as per protocol to mix with additives.
  • Store samples appropriately ⁣ for ⁤transport.

Post-Collection Procedures

  • Dispose of sharps in designated container.
  • Ensure patient comfort⁢ and provide aftercare instructions.
  • Complete⁢ documentation ‌in the patient’s chart.

Case Studies Highlighting the Importance of the Order of Draw

Case Study 1: Contamination Leading to False Results

A hospital lab reported skewed coagulation test results. Investigation revealed the phlebotomist skipped⁣ the proper sequence,⁣ leading to contamination from a prior tube with EDTA. Adherence to the order of draw corrected the ‍issue and ⁣prevented future⁤ errors.

Case Study 2: Improving Lab Turnaround Time

By implementing strict training on the order of draw, a clinic reduced‍ sample rejection rates by 20%, speeding ‍up ‍diagnosis ‌and treatment. Consistent technique ensures the‍ reliability of blood tests and reduces delays.
